IOWA CITY, IA (AP) -- Senior guard Matt Gatens scored 19 points and Iowa beat No. 13 Michigan 75-59 on Saturday.
Roy Devyn Marble added 13 points for Iowa (11-8, 3-3 Big Ten), which snapped an ugly two-game losing streak and picked up its first conference home win.
Iowa went on a 10-0 run in the second half to build a 53-37 lead and the game was never close again. The spurt included a 3-pointer by Gatens and a dunk by Melsahn Basabe - both on assists from backup point guard Bryce Cartwright. Gatens sealed the game with another 3-pointer that gave Iowa a 63-48 lead.
Freshman point guard Trey Burke led Michigan (14-4, 4-2) with 19 points despite sitting out much of the first half after picking up two fouls.
